Amritapur Population - Kheri, Uttar Pradesh

Amritapur is a medium size village located in Lakhimpur Tehsil of Kheri district, Uttar Pradesh with total 221 families residing. The Amritapur village has population of 1280 of which 691 are males while 589 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Amritapur village population of children with age 0-6 is 241 which makes up 18.83 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Amritapur village is 852 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Amritapur as per census is 772,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.

Amritapur village has lower liter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Amritapur village was 43.89 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Amritapur Male literacy stands at 51.71 % while female literacy rate was 34.92 %.

Amritapur Data

Particulars Total Male Female
Total No. of Houses 221 - -
Population 1,280 691 589
Child (0-6) 241 136 105
Schedule Caste 94 51 43
Schedule Tribe 88 53 35
Literacy 43.89 % 51.71 % 34.92 %
Total Workers 404 340 64
Main Worker 395 - -
Marginal Worker 9 2 7

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 7.34 % while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 6.88 % of total population in Amritapur village.

Work Profile

In Amritapur village out of total population, 404 were engaged in work activities. 97.77 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 2.23 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 404 workers engaged in Main Work, 178 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 209 were Agricultural labourer.
